Subject: HSM delivery — Thornfield data room, records copy

To the dispatch desk,

The hardware security module from Ostermark Devices is scheduled for delivery Thursday morning under dual-custody rules. Please ensure the tamper-evident seal number is recorded at collection and re-verified on arrival, with both entries filed in the transport register for the records team. No deviations from the approved route are permitted. The courier hand-over instruction follows.

handover note for yagef-bagep: the drudor pelius courier leaves the kasdor zorvan norir ledger at gate 8016 under passcode 755406

Welcome aboard! You'll be helping move the Copperfen monolith from the old script-soup build onto Forgecell, our hermetic build system. Short version: every target declares its inputs explicitly, nothing reads from the host machine, and caching actually works for once. Start by porting the `reports` module — it has the fewest weird dependencies. Expect some yak-shaving around vendored libraries; that's normal. To pull prebuilt toolchains from the internal Forgecell artifact cache, authenticate with the key below.

gateway credential: kto3_qfe

Subject: Ownership change — RouteMind driver-assignment heuristic

As part of the Q3 reshuffle at Corvadel Logistics, ownership of the driver-assignment heuristic is moving teams. For your security review, note that the model inputs, fairness constraints, and audit logging remain unchanged; only the on-call rotation and approval chain differ. All access requests should now route through the new owner, whose name appears below.

signatory, yagap-bawig: Ulaath Eliath